Description/Abstract

Efficient, room-temperature operation of a Tm:YAG laser, end-pumped by the re-shaped output beam from a 20W diode-bar, is reported. At a rod mount temperature of 20°C and with 13.5W of diode pump power incident on the Tm:YAG rod we obtained 4.1W of output at 2.013µm in a near-diffraction-limited beam with corresponding M2 values in orthogonal planes of 1.4 and 1.2. The prospects for further power-scaling are discussed.
